[In addition to the employment policy, since the early Han Dynasty, important positions have generally been monopolized by lieutenants, and they can be officials from generation to generation through the method of appointing their sons]

[In order to change this situation, Emperor Wu improved the talent promotion mechanism from the system, vigorously developed the scouting system, and promulgated the edict of seeking talents, boldly promoting talents from poor families or humble backgrounds without sticking to one pattern]

[Appointment according to ability, generous rewards, so that Emperor Wu gave birth to many political and military talents, and assisted Emperor Wu to create incomparable achievements]

[However, Emperor Wu also had strict requirements on officials, thinking that "having talents but not making full use of them is the same as having no talents". Countless officials who were incompetent or deceived him were killed, and the same was true for the prime minister]
